Parc Astérix, nestled just a stone's throw away from Paris, France, stands as a beacon of fun, spirited adventure, and indelible memories for visitors of all ages. This theme park, inspired by the famous comic book series "Asterix," which tells the story of gallant Gaulish warriors battling the Roman Empire, offers a unique blend of historical intrigue and modern-day amusement. Its enchanting attractions and immersive experiences have solidified its reputation as a must-visit destination for both locals and international travelers alike.
Upon stepping into Parc Astérix, one is immediately transported into the vibrant world of Asterix, Obelix, and their valiant friends. The park is divided into six distinct areas, each themed around different historical periods and mythologies, including Ancient Gaul, the Roman Empire, Ancient Greece, the Vikings, and more. This meticulous theming is evident in the architecture, the rides, and even the food, ensuring a fully immersive experience. Thrill-seekers will be delighted by the variety of rides available, from the heart-stopping drop of the Thunder of Zeus, one of Europe's largest wooden roller coasters, to the dizzying spins of the Discobelix.
However, Parc Astérix's charm isn't solely in its adrenaline-pumping rides. The park also offers a plethora of shows that cater to all ages and preferences, ranging from mesmerizing live stunt shows in the Roman Arena to enchanting dolphin and sea lion performances in the aquatic theatre. For the younger adventurers, Parc Astérix presents an array of gentler rides and attractions, ensuring that the magical experience can be enjoyed by the entire family. Moreover, the park's dedication to authenticity and quality extends to its culinary offerings, with a variety of restaurants and food stalls serving both traditional French cuisine and international dishes, all tailored to enhance the thematic experience.
Despite its thematic depth and variety of attractions, Parc Astérix also prides itself on its seasonal events, which add an extra layer of enchantment to the visitor experience. The park goes all out for Halloween, transforming into a spooky wonderland, and celebrates Gaulish Christmas with festive decorations and special shows, making it a year-round destination.

Did You Know These Facts About Enjoy the Parc Asterix ?
Opened in 1989, Parc Asterix features themed areas dedicated to ancient civilizations like the Romans, Egyptians, and Vikings, blending humor with historical settings.
Parc Asterix offers live shows featuring characters from the comics, including Asterix, Obelix, and their Roman adversaries, bringing the beloved comic to life.
In addition to attractions for children, the park is known for its thrilling rides and attractions, making it a fun destination for both families and thrill-seekers.
The park is home to over 40 rides, including the famous wooden roller coaster "Tonnerre de Zeus," one of the largest in Europe.
Parc Asterix, located just outside of Paris, is a popular theme park based on the famous French comic series "Asterix," which follows the adventures of a Gaulish village.
